Pelion Overview

Nestled in the heart of Greece, the Agriolefkes ski resort in Pelion offers a unique winter experience, boasting an exceptional natural environment with panoramic sea views. Despite its small size, this resort offers a blend of snow-covered slopes and breathtaking scenery, making it a must-visit destination for ski lovers.

The resort is situated at an altitude of 1,170 - 1,471 meters and is surrounded by Agriolefkes trees, which adds to its charm. With the Aegean Sea covering 270 degrees of the view from the top of the slopes, visitors are treated to a truly spectacular sight. The resort is known to be particularly beautiful when the north-east wind blows, filling the area with a generous amount of snow.

Agriolefkes ski resort is equipped with a range of facilities to cater to both beginner and professional skiers. A variety of stages are available, along with rental equipment and instructional groups. Its family-friendly environment and local company shop offering hot drinks and snacks make it an appealing spot for a day out.

However, visitors should note that the access to the ski center is only possible by car and the old infrastructure could use some updates. The lifts, although functional, are rather old, and the ski equipment available for hire is heavily used. Despite these shortcomings, the resort's personnel are known for their friendliness and their teaching skills are highly commendable.

In addition, the resort also offers non-ski activities such as hiking on snow paths, providing visitors with opportunities to enjoy the awesome views of the Pelio mountain and sea. Despite its occasional closure during the winter and its lack of phone contact, the Agriolefkes Pelion ski resort remains a cherished spot for winter sports enthusiasts, offering a unique combination of skiing and stunning sea views.

Frequently asked questions about Pelion

Where is Pelion?

Pelion is a ski resort in Zagora-Mouresi, Chania, Greece, at coordinates 39.8100, 22.8600.

How many lifts does Pelion have?

Pelion has 5 lifts, serving 124 ac of skiable terrain.

How high is Pelion?

Pelion has a peak elevation of 1,471 m, a base elevation of 1,170 m and a vertical drop of 301 m.
